Child Family Health International (CFHI) is a nonprofit recognized by the United Nations that offers socially responsible Global Health Internships for students of all levels interested in health or medicine. CFHI staff will be hosting an info session on campus on Tuesday March 12th at 4pm in 3100 Hornbake Library, South Wing. They will discuss and take questions on their global health programs abroad and scholarship opportunities, application process, and what to expect on a CFHI program. Through CFHI participants go on 4-16 week placements alongside local healthcare professionals in underserved communities. Participants rotate through clinics and public health facilities, attend health lectures, and become immersed in the healthcare system of the community. Over 50% of CFHI program fees go back to underserved communities abroad.

What a financial adviser does: • Identifies and sets appointments with potential clients. • Meets with clients to assess their financial needs. • Develops a customized financial plan to address each client’s outlined goals. • Maintains strong relationships with clients, helping them to track their progress over time. • Provides ongoing consultation and support.
